  • Episode 113: EF Interview with Niklas Åström (Drums)
    Jan 2 2026
    Hailing from the musical landscapes of Swedish coastal city Gothenburg, EF emerged already in 2003. This post-rock ensemble quickly captivated audiences with their emotionally charged instrumentals which they skillfully blended with northern melancholy, indie rock riffs and infusing the short energetic bursts of hardcore into their compositions. What truly did set them apart from other bands at this point of time was the use of tender vocals which made their melodies compelling to a diverse fanbase. The debut album, "Give me beauty...Or give me death!" (2006), marked the commencement of a spellbinding adventure into EF's immersive soundscapes. And with the subsequent releases "I Am Responsible" (2008), "Mourning Golden Morning" (2010), and "Ceremonies" (2013), EF solidified their standing in the post-rock realms. The band's live performances, renowned for intensity and visual allure, added an extra layer to their enigmatic allure and the band have done 400+ shows all over Europe and Asia. In November 2022, EF continued their musical odyssey with the release of their latest album, "We Salute You, You and You!" on the esteemed German post-metal label Pelagic Records. This latest offering would be the bands 5th, their first in 10 years and a celebration of their 20 years together as a creative force. ”We Salute You, You and You!” further showcased EF's ability to craftevocative soundscapes, contributing another chapter to their captivating journey. 2026 marks the 20th anniversary of ”Give me beauty...Or give me death!” which of course calls for a celebration. The band really wants to give their debut album the love it deserves and decides to re-record the full album. They want to make it tight, bombastic and give the songs a kiss of modern EF. Focusing on making orchestral arrangements bigger, the explosive parts bolder and even creating a new ”gem” out of an old outro. This is surely a heart project for the members, for the old fans, but hopefully will be embraced and find a place in new hearts as well. I got to sit down with drummer Niklas Åström where we talked about how the band started, going back and recording the 20th anniversary of, "Give Me Beauty...Or Give Me Death!", and the music scene in Gothenburg.   • Episode 112: Still In Love Interview with Nick Worthington (Vocals)
    Dec 19 2025
    Containing members of Dead Swans, Throats, Brutality Will Prevail, Last Witness and Bring Me The Horizon (to name a few!), Still In love is the brainchild of UKHC’s brightest talents. Following their acclaimed Withdrawal Symptoms EPs, Still In Love have carved out a distinct identity within the UK hardcore scene. Their music blends raw aggression with introspective lyricism, drawing comparisons to bands like Cursed, Blacklisted and Have Heart. Recovery Language delves into themes of personal struggle, resilience, and emotional catharsis, offering a sonic journey through the complexities of the human experience. The album's soundscape is a fusion of relentless riffs, dynamic rhythms, and poignant melodies, reflecting the band's evolution and depth. I got to sit down with vocalist Nick Worthington where we talked about the recording process for the bands debut album, 'Recovery Language', how the band started and skateboarding.
